Simple Touch
2833 W 8th St Ste 204
Los Angeles, CA 90005
Simple Touch is a reliable cell phone service provider located in the heart of Los Angeles, CA. Known for its straightforward plans and excellent customer service, it caters to a diverse range of mobile needs. Whether you're looking for affordable options or the latest smartphone, Simple Touch offers a user-friendly experience for all customers.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.